Roma vs Bayer Leverkusen Prediction and Betting Tips: 3/1 and 15/1 picks for Semi-Final Clash
Bayer Leverkusen will look to maintain their unbeaten record across all competitions this season as they take on Roma this Thursday in a UEFA Europa League semi-final first leg at the Stadio Olimpico.

Roma enter the match with confidence high having secured a victory over AC Milan in their previous quarter-final, triumphing 3-1 on aggregate. Following a 1-0 win in the first leg, they clinched a 2-1 victory in the return fixture at home, with Gianluca Mancini and Paulo Dybala finding the net in the decisive second leg.
Meanwhile, Leverkusen also enter the semi-finals on a high note, having defeated West Ham United 3-1 on aggregate in their last Europa League outing and being crowned Bundesliga champions. With a 2-0 win in the first leg at home, they managed a 1-1 draw in the subsequent match. Jeremie Frimpong's solitary goal in the second leg secured their advancement. Impressively, Leverkusen boast an unbeaten streak of 46 games in all competitions, with 38 wins and 8 draws during this period.
Roma vs Bayer Leverkusen Tips
Romelu Lukaku has resumed full training for the hosts and should spearhead the attack for the hosts on Thursday, but the Roma player we like the look of in the anytime scorer market is Lukaku’s teammate Pablo Dybala.
Should Lukaku not start the game, there will be a much greater impetus on Dybala to provide the goals for his side, but whatever happens we feel the 3/1 for the Argentine to find the net anytime in the match represents value.
Across his last nine starts for Roma in all competitions, Dybala has managed seven goals. He found the net against AC Milan in the quarter-finals against AC Milan and in the Round of 16 against Brighton and can do so again here.
Despite their remarkable unbeaten run Leverkusen have failed to shut their opponents in four of their last five matches, including conceding two at Qarabag and once at West Ham in this competition.
All four of Roma and Leverkusen’s most recent four matches have featured Over 2.5 goal and we think a goal-laden affair looks likely in the Italian capital. One of the key pillars of Leverkusen’s success this season is Florian Wirtz who is one of only a couple of players from Europe's top-five leagues to hit double figures for both goals and assists.
No player has created more chances from open play than Wirtz in the Europa League this season (24). The 20-year-old – who turns 21 on Friday - has scored 11 goals in the competition, more than any other player under the age of 21 since the competition’s rebrand in 2009-10.
